易语言实现MySQL两表数据比较技巧
易语言mysql两个表比较

首页 2025-07-24 04:23:57



易语言与MySQL:两个表比较的艺术 在数据处理的广阔天地中,表比较是一项至关重要的技术

    无论是在数据分析、数据迁移、还是数据同步等场景中,我们都需要对比两个或多个表的数据差异

    本文将深入探讨在易语言环境下,如何高效地进行MySQL中两个表的比较操作,从而帮助读者更好地掌握这一实用技能

     一、背景介绍 易语言,作为一种简洁易懂的编程语言,深受广大程序爱好者的喜爱

    其丰富的库函数和直观的编程界面,使得复杂的数据处理任务变得触手可及

    而MySQL,作为当下最流行的关系型数据库之一,广泛应用于各行各业

    因此,掌握易语言与MySQL的交互操作,特别是表比较技术,对于提升数据处理能力具有重要意义

     二、表比较的基本概念 表比较,顾名思义,就是对比两个数据库表中的数据,找出它们之间的差异

    这些差异可能包括记录的增加、删除、修改等

    通过表比较,我们可以迅速定位数据变化,进而采取相应的处理措施

     三、易语言中的MySQL表比较方法 在易语言中,进行MySQL表比较通常涉及以下几个步骤: 1.连接MySQL数据库:首先,我们需要使用易语言的数据库连接函数,建立起与MySQL数据库的连接

    这一步是后续操作的基础

     2.选择对比的表:确定需要对比的两个表

    这两个表应该具有相似的结构,至少在我们关心的字段上应该是对应的

     3.提取数据:通过SQL查询语句,分别从两个表中提取出需要对比的数据

    这里可以根据实际情况,选择提取全部数据或者部分数据

     4.数据对比:将提取出的两组数据进行逐条对比

    对比的过程可以通过循环遍历来实现,也可以使用更高级的算法来提高效率

     5.展示结果:将对比的结果以适当的方式展示出来

    这可能包括在易语言的界面上显示差异记录,或者将结果输出到文件、数据库等其他存储介质中

     四、优化与注意事项 在进行易语言中的MySQL表比较时,以下几点值得特别关注: 1.性能优化:当处理大量数据时,性能问题尤为突出

    因此,我们应该尽量优化SQL查询语句,减少不必要的数据提取

    同时,也可以考虑使用分页、索引等技术来提高查询效率

     2.异常处理:在数据对比过程中,可能会遇到各种异常情况,如数据类型不匹配、空值处理等

    因此,我们需要编写完善的异常处理代码,以确保程序的稳定运行

     3.安全性考虑:在与数据库交互时,安全性是不可忽视的问题

    我们应该使用参数化查询来防止SQL注入攻击,并定期更新和检查数据库的安全设置

     五、实例演示 为了更加直观地展示易语言中MySQL表比较的操作过程,本文还将提供一个简单的实例演示

    通过这个实例,读者可以更加清晰地理解表比较的具体步骤和实现方法

     (此处可以插入具体的易语言代码示例和操作步骤说明) 六、结语 通过本文的探讨,我们不难发现,易语言与MySQL的结合为表比较操作提供了强大的支持

    只要我们掌握了正确的方法和技巧,就能够轻松应对各种复杂的数据处理任务

    希望本文能够对读者在易语言环境下的MySQL表比较工作有所帮助

    

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道